Will Prime Minister Narendra Modi's dream project of bullet train not be completed? This question arises as the amount of land that this project requires has not been found. This bullet train is to run from Ahmedabad in Gujarat to Mumbai in Maharashtra, for which Japan has given a soft loan. But to complete this project, National High Speed Rail Corporation Limited needs land. The farmers of Gujarat were somehow persuaded by the government and almost 90 percent of the land was acquired there. But due to the opposition of farmers in Maharashtra, land is not being acquired. The project was to be completed by December 2023, but due to non-availability of land and the opposition of the Shiv Sena-NCP-Congress government in Maharashtra, the project does not seem to be possible till the deadline.
